As technology continues to advance rapidly, appliances are becoming increasingly sophisticated. This technological evolution impacts how appliances are repaired and maintained. Here’s how appliance repair services are adapting to these changes and the role they play in managing modern technology
Many new appliances are designed to integrate with smart home systems, allowing for remote control and monitoring. Repair services need to understand how these systems work and how to troubleshoot issues related to connectivity and integration. Technicians are increasingly required to have knowledge of smart home technology and be able to diagnose and fix problems that arise from the interaction between appliances and home automation systems.
Modern appliances often rely on software and firmware to function correctly. Issues with software or firmware can lead to malfunctioning appliances. Repair services now need to be skilled in performing software updates and troubleshooting software-related problems. This may involve working with manufacturers to obtain updates and understanding how to apply them correctly.
Advances in diagnostic tools are revolutionizing appliance repair. New tools can provide more accurate diagnostics and faster identification of issues. For example, advanced multimeters, thermal imaging cameras, and diagnostic software are increasingly used to pinpoint problems and ensure efficient repairs. Technicians must be adept at using these tools to enhance their diagnostic capabilities.
As appliances become more complex, ongoing training and certification are essential for repair professionals. Technicians need to stay current with the latest technological advancements, including new appliance models and emerging repair techniques. Manufacturers and industry organizations often provide specialized training programs to help technicians stay up-to-date.
With the rise of smart appliances, data security and privacy have become significant concerns. Appliances connected to the internet can potentially be vulnerable to cyber-attacks. Repair services must be aware of these risks and follow best practices to ensure that customer data remains secure during repair processes. This includes safeguarding personal information and adhering to privacy regulations.
